High is currently serving the School Board of Volusia County as Construction Manager for the Starmer Ranaldi Architecture designed Master Plan Redevelopment of Ormond Beach Middle School. The project will essentially replace every building on campus while maintaining full student occupancy throughout. As of May 1, 2011, the project has started the third phase of construction. The first phase (June 2008-December 2009), included renovations of the gymnasium building and new construction of a two story classroom building and two story Administration/Media Center. It was completed on time and under budget. The second phase which was completed March 14, 2011 was 5 weeks ahead of schedule and under budget. The savings from the previous phases of construction have allowed the third phase to include a new Career Education Building as well as the originally planned 2-story classroom building. Completion of the final phase of the redevelopment is currently planned for Fall 2012.

Phase 1:
Building 5 – Gymnasium Renovation – 21,874 sf
Building 1 – Administration/Media Center – 20,400 sf
Building 2 – Classroom (7th and 8th Grade) – 44,730 sf
Temporary Parent Pick-up Loop and Visitor Parking
Temporary Bus Loop and Teacher Parking

Phase 2:
Building 4 – Café / Music / Central Plant – 33,992 sf
Building 7 – Tower Yard

Phase 3:
Building 3 – Classroom (ESE and 6th Grade) – 51,189 sf
Building 6 – Career Education – 14,332 sf
Landscaping and Outdoor Play Courts
Permanent Bus Loop and Teacher Parking
Permanent Visitor Parking
